Culinary Creations

By Tina Chung, Culinary World Tour Teacher

Our talented culinary students wrapped up their Vietnamese cuisine unit with creativity and teamwork!

From steaming bowls of pho to crispy bánh xèo (Vietnamese crepes), golden chả giò (spring rolls), savory sườn nướng (grilled pork chops), fragrant chicken lemongrass rice bowls with flavourful dipping sauces, and sweet bánh cam (sesame ball donuts)—every dish was bursting with flavour!

They even crafted bánh mì sandwiches with homemade pickles, layering crunch, spice and freshness in every bite.

Using their leftover ingredients, students came together for one final surprise challenge—and they absolutely nailed it!
